Common Land Clearing Jobs
Land clearing for new construction - preparing the site to build on by removing trees, brush, and debris.
Property expansion projects - creating open space for landscaping, gardens, or additional structures.
Storm damage cleanup - removing fallen trees and debris after severe weather events.
Vegetation removal - clearing overgrown areas to improve property access and safety.
Fire prevention clearing - reducing brush and undergrowth to minimize wildfire risk.
Land grading and leveling - shaping the terrain for proper drainage and future development.
Land Clearing Questions
What types of land clearing projects are available? Land clearing services typically include removing trees, shrubs, and debris to prepare properties for construction, farming, or landscaping.
Is land clearing suitable for residential properties? Yes, land clearing can help homeowners create open spaces, build new structures, or improve yard accessibility.
What equipment is used for land clearing?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and stump grinders are commonly used to efficiently clear land.
Are there permits required for land clearing? Permit requirements vary by location; it’s advisable to check local regulations before beginning a project.
